#309c97 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#309c97 is composed of 18.8% red, 61.2%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.2%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 177.2 degrees, a saturation of 52.9% and a lightness of 40%. #309c97 color hex could be obtained by blending #60ffff with #00392f.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#309c97 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#309c97 has RGB values of R:48, G:156,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.03,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 3185815.

Shades and Tints of #309c97
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020606 is the darkest color, while #f6fcfc is the lightest one.
